Alright, let's tackle Chapter 8, also known as "Traitor's Brand." This one's at Fort Jinya and the main goal is pretty simple: defeat the boss. Don't let the name fool you, it's more straightforward than it sounds, even with a bunch of enemies around.
Walkthrough
- 1You'll start at Fort Jinya. The map has a decent number of enemies, especially on higher difficulties, so make sure your units are ready. The core strategy here is to pair up your Avatar with Gunter. This gives your Avatar a solid defensive boost and allows Gunter to chip away at enemies.
- 2Use Azura to refresh your main attacking pair (Avatar/Gunter) so they can get extra turns. Keep Jakob or Felicia nearby to heal any damage taken. If you've been training Mozu, she's also a great addition here, especially if you need more damage output.
- 3Your Avatar's Dragonstone is your best friend in this chapter. It's powerful enough to one-shot many enemies, particularly those with lower Resistance stats. Don't underestimate its power!
- 4Keep an eye out for a Dragon Vein on the map. Activating it turns a section into a healing zone, which can be a lifesaver if you're taking a lot of damage. However, it's not strictly necessary to win, so don't stress too much if you can't reach it. You can also use this opportunity to level up your healers like Felicia or Jakob if they need the experience.
- 5There are a few chests scattered around the sides of the map. If you have Chest Keys, it's worth grabbing them, but be aware that some enemies like Saizo and Orochi won't attack unless you get close. Yukimura, the boss, is pretty stationary.
- 6Try to use your less-leveled characters to take down the tougher enemies like Saizo and Orochi. Your Avatar is probably pretty strong by now, so save them for the main boss. These enemies give a good chunk of experience, so it's a great way to train up your other units.
- 7When you're ready to finish the chapter, focus your attacks on Yukimura. Gang up on him with your strongest units to defeat him in a single turn if possible.
New Allies:
- Sakura (Shrine Maiden): Joins automatically at the end of the chapter.
- Hana (Samurai): Joins automatically at the end of the chapter. She's very fast.
- Subaki (Sky Knight): Joins automatically at the end of the chapter. He's a bit slower but more durable.
- Kaze (Ninja): Joins automatically at the end of the chapter. He's your new Locktouch unit!
